milia Hazelip (1937–2003) was a pioneering permaculturist who adapted Masanobu Fukuoka’s natural farming principles into a regenerative, no-till gardening system suited for temperate climates. Her Synergistic Garden method emphasizes working with nature rather than against it, creating self-sustaining ecosystems that require minimal human intervention. Core Principles of Synergistic Gardening: ✅ No Dig / No Till – Preserves soil structure, microbiology, and fertility by avoiding disruption. ✅ Living Mulch & Green Manures – Plants (like clover or vetch) act as a living mulch, suppressing weeds and fixing nitrogen. ✅ Permanent Raised Beds – Aerated, well-drained beds prevent soil compaction and encourage deep root growth. ✅ Plant Guilds & Polycultures – Diverse plantings mimic natural ecosystems, reducing pests and diseases. ✅ Self-Fertilizing System – Plant residues decompose in place, feeding the soil naturally without external inputs. ✅ Minimal Watering – Deep mulch and healthy soil retain moisture, reducing irrigation needs. Hazelip’s method aligns with permaculture ethics (Earth Care, People Care, Fair Share) by creating low-maintenance, high-yield gardens that regenerate the land over time. Legacy & Influence: Her work inspired many permaculture practitioners, demonstrating how sustainable food production can thrive without chemicals, tilling, or excessive labor.
